Description of the education system
European has around 4.000 higher eduacation institutions with over 17 million students and 1.5 million staff in the world.
In 1999, the ministers in charge of higher education from 29 European countries agreed to introduce a set of reforms in their national higher education systems with a view to setting up a European Higher Eduaction Area by 2010. This Bologna Declaration set in motion a series of actions to make European higher education more compatible and comparable, more competitive, and attractive for Europe's citizens and for students and scholars from other continents.

Bologna Declaration consist of :
-Adoption of  a system of easily readable and comparable degress
-Adoption of a three-cycle system, often called bachelor, master, and doctorate
-Establishment of a system of credits
-Promotion of mobilty
-Promotion of the European cooperation in quality assurance
-Promotion of the European dimension in higher eduaction

How much is the scholarship worth ?
The Erasmus Mundus Scholarship are a full scholarship programme covering tuition fees, living costs, and return airfares.
- EMMC: 24,000 Euro per student for one-year indcludes :
  - Travel expenses
  - Tuition fees
  - Monthly stipends
  - Accommodation, etc
or 48.000,- Euro per students for a two-year course. Stipends for scholar will cover each a three month period namely 14.800 Euro per scholar (accomodation, monthly stipend, travel expenses, etc)
